Monoazadiene Complexes of Early Transition Metals. 2.1 Syntheses and Structures of Titanium 1-Aza-1,3-diene Complexes and Their Reactions with Ketones

Abstract: The novel dark green or violet and air-sensitive 1-aza-1,3-diene titanocene complexes Cp2Ti[N(R1)CHC(R2)CH(Ph)] [R1 = t-Bu, R2 = H (7a); R1 = C6H4-4-Me, R2 = H (7b); R1 = c-C6H11, R2 = Me (7c)] were prepared by the complexation of the 1-aza-1,3-dienes 1a−c to the titanocene “Cp2Ti” generated in situ by reduction of Cp2TiCl2 with magnesium. The solid-state structure of 7c shows a bent azatitanacyclic ring with a fold angle of 130.9(4)°. A series of electron-deficient 14e 1-aza-1,3-diene titanium complexes CpTi… Show more
